Subject: SDK parity ownership change

Hello plugin authors,

Starting next sprint, responsibility for maintaining feature parity between the Kestrelwave Java SDK and the Go SDK is moving off the core platform team. Parity gaps, including the pending batch-upload and token-refresh differences, will be tracked in a public matrix updated each release. Please route parity questions through the plugin forum rather than direct channels. The new parity owner is named below.

approver of yajef-fajef = Oliwyn Silion Kasok Kasox

Prepared for the incoming director at Fennrock Instruments. Tidewheel now covers 42 accredited resellers across three territories, contributing 19% of unit sales. Margin per reseller varies widely; the bottom quartile is loss-making after support costs. Proposed actions: tiered accreditation, minimum annual volume commitments, and consolidated training delivered twice yearly. The partner council has reviewed and broadly supports these changes. One confidential strategic consideration is appended below for your review.

board note of kageg-bahof: The renewal with Holwynax Holdings closes at $2 million a year, 5 percent below the last contract. Project Ulaath slips by two quarters because of the supplier delay.

Leadership Review Briefing — Hedging Position

Following volatility in the crown-linked markets serving our Veldran branches, Treasury recommends extending forward contracts on roughly sixty percent of projected receivables through next fiscal year. Branch managers should note that local pricing autonomy remains unchanged, though margin floors will be recalculated monthly. Costs of the program are absorbed centrally. The strategic rationale is summarized in the note below.

board note of kagep-yahig: Only 9 of the 120 pilot accounts renewed Quenix, so a churn review is set for April 1.

Hi Priya — quick handover for the Ferngate pipeline. Two build agents drifted about 40 seconds last week, which broke artifact timestamp validation and caused spurious "stale build" rejections. NTP sync is now enforced on boot; no open incidents. If rejections recur, check agent clocks first, not the signer. Re-sign any affected artifacts with the current release key below.

rollout seal: bky4_x7Gc